Instructions:

1. Set the oven temperature to 350°F. Use foil or parchment paper to line a baking sheet; it will make cleaning a breeze.
2. Mix the Italian bread crumbs, garlic powder, salt, pepper, and grated Parmesan cheese in a small basin.
Third, use a paper towel to wipe any extra moisture from the pork chops, then coat them evenly with olive oil.
Press down hard to make sure the Parmesan breadcrumb mixture adheres to the pork chops as you dip them into the mixture.
5. After preparing the baking sheet, layer the greased pork chops on top. Bake for 40 to 45 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 145°F, or 63°C.
6. You have the option to broil the pork chops for a couple of extra minutes if you want a crunchier exterior.
After the pork chops are done cooking, take them out of the oven and set them aside to rest for 5 minutes.
8. Plate the Parmesan Baked Pork Chops and serve them hot, with whatever sides you choose. Savor!
